Founder Voices (Episode 5): Cristina Ruiz, sustainability strategist and humanitarian consultant
At Cottage Factory, Founder Voices is where stories of ambition, impact, and resilience come to life.
In Episode 5, Clement Akran sits down with Cristina Ruiz—an impact strategist, social innovator, and global development expert. With years of experience shaping inclusive value chains across continents, Cristina brings a powerful perspective on transforming systems from within. In this insightful conversation, she shares stories from the field, explores the intersection of equity and enterprise, and reflects on how we can build a more just and connected world.
In this thought-provoking and globally focused conversation, Cristina Ruiz shares her journey across the worlds of international development, social innovation, and systems change. Drawing on her deep experience in Europe, Africa, and Latin America, Cristina unpacks the realities of driving impact across borders—and why centring equity, collaboration, and local voice is essential.
We explore what it means to challenge traditional power structures, design for inclusion, and reimagine global value chains through a feminist and decolonial lens. Cristina reflects on the pivotal moments that shaped her work, the lessons she's still learning, and the role of connection in creating lasting change.
This episode was recorded on Saturday, 28 June 2025.
